My friends and I were casually walking back to the hotel and looking for a place for dinner. We stumbled across this place. We walked in and spoke with the owner who is French himself. Even though it was packed we were accommodated within about 8-10 minutes. There were 4 of us.
The menu has all the French traditional dishes you expect. I ordered the escargot and other appetisers included oysters and French onion soup.
The food tasted incredible! Fresh, hot and seasoned well. I ordered the salon, other orders included beef and duck. Everyone was completely satisfied with their dishes and I can tell you my salmon was amazing. Our dinner was accompanied by great Malbec (when in Argentina get great Malbec)wine.
The ambiance in this place was great, very lively and loud as everyone had been enjoying their dinner.
The price was very, very reasonable. I can't say if it's expensive for locals with the Argentine peso, but for US dollars this dinner was super cheap for us.
A must go if you're in the neighbourhood or in BA!
